How to fill out Wireless Local Area Network Proposal

01
Begin with an executive summary outlining the purpose of the proposal.
02
Introduce the current network situation and explain the need for a Wireless Local Area Network.
03
Define the scope of the project, including the area the network will cover and the number of users it will support.
04
Detail the technical specifications of the wireless network, such as equipment, technologies, and security measures.
05
Outline a planned budget including costs for equipment, installation, and maintenance.
06
Provide a timeline for project implementation, including key milestones.
07
Include a section on potential challenges and solutions to mitigate them.
08
Conclude with a call to action, prompting stakeholders to approve the proposal.

Dimensioning in network planning refers to the process of determining the capacity requirements of a network. This includes deciding on the number and size of the network elements (like routers, switches, or links) that are needed to handle the expected traffic load. Take a college campus as an example.
A wireless LAN (WLAN) is a wireless computer network that links two or more devices using wireless communication to form a local area network (LAN) within a limited area such as a home, school, computer laboratory, campus, or office building.
